Three Ukrainians are one step away from the establishment of the Aus Open. Who will they play with in the qualifying final?

Published

on

The second round of qualification matches were held on January 14. Australian Open 2026.

advanced to the finals in the election three Ukrainian tennis players: Yulia Starodubtseva (WTA 110), Daria Snigur (WTA 136) and Angelina Kalinina (WTA 178). Vitaly Sachko (ATR 166) left the major.

Starodubtseva defeated Despina Papamikhail (Greece, WTA 160), Snigur defeated Carson Brenstein (Canada, WTA 179), Kalinina defeated Anouk Koevermans (Netherlands, WTA 192) and Sachko lost to Liam Draxl (Canada, ATP 145).

In the qualifying finals, Starodubtseva will face Victoria Tomova (Bulgaria, WTA 128), Snigur will compete with Alexandra Sasnovich (WTA 102), and Kalinina will compete with Maya Khwalinskaya (Poland, WTA 145).

The final round of Australian Open qualifiers will be held on January 15.

Results of Ukrainian representatives in the second round of Aus Open 2026 qualifiers:

  • Q2: Yulia Starodubtseva [6] – Despina Papamikhail – 6:1, 6:2
  • Q2: Daria Snigur – Carson Brenstein – 6:4, 4:2, RET., Brenstein
  • Q2: Angelina Kalinina – Anouk Koevermans – 7:6 (8:6), 6:0
  • Q2: Vitaly Sachko – Liam Draxl [20] – 3:6, 7:5, 6:7 (7:10)

The opponents of the Ukrainian representatives in the Aus Open 2026 qualifiers final are:

  • Q3: Yulia Starodubtseva [6] – Victoria Tomova [18]
  • Q3: Daria Snigur – 🏳️ Alexandra Sasnovich [8]
  • Q3: Angelina Kalinina – Maya Khvalinskaya
